算法运行的算力解析其重要性与提升策略
资源推荐
2025-03-08 02:00
128
联系人:
联系方式:
随着科技的飞速发展,算法在各个领域的应用日益广泛。从搜索引擎到自动驾驶,从金融风控到医疗诊断,算法已经成为了现代科技的核心驱动力。算法的运行离不开强大的算力支持。本文将深入探讨算法运行的算力,分析其重要性以及提升策略。
一、算法运行的算力的重要性
1. 影响算法性能:算力是算法运行的基础,它决定了算法的执行速度和效果。强大的算力可以使算法更快地处理海量数据,提高算法的准确性和效率。
2. 适应复杂场景:在复杂的应用场景中,算法需要处理的数据量和计算量巨大。强大的算力可以帮助算法在短时间内完成复杂的计算任务,适应各种复杂场景。
3. 促进技术创新:随着算力的不断提升,算法的边界也在不断拓展。强大的算力为技术创新提供了有力支持,推动了人工智能、大数据等领域的快速发展。
二、提升算法运行的算力策略
1. 优化算法设计:在算法设计阶段,充分考虑算法的复杂度和计算量,采用高效的算法模型和算法优化技术,降低算法对算力的需求。
2. 采用并行计算:将算法分解成多个子任务,通过并行计算的方式提高算法的执行效率。现代计算机体系结构,如GPU、FPGA等,为并行计算提供了良好的硬件支持。
3. 利用云计算资源:借助云计算平台,将算法运行在分布式计算环境中,充分利用云计算资源,提高算法运行的算力。
4. 开发专用硬件:针对特定算法,开发专用硬件加速器,如神经网络处理器、图像处理芯片等,以降低算法对算力的需求。
5. 优化数据存储和传输:在算法运行过程中,合理优化数据存储和传输方式,减少数据访问延迟,提高算法的执行效率。
6. 节能降耗:在提升算力的注重节能降耗,降低算法运行过程中的能耗,实现可持续发展。
算法运行的算力是影响算法性能和推广应用的关键因素。在人工智能、大数据等领域的快速发展中,提升算法运行的算力具有重要意义。通过优化算法设计、采用并行计算、利用云计算资源、开发专用硬件、优化数据存储和传输以及节能降耗等策略,可以有效提升算法运行的算力,为我国科技创新和产业升级提供有力支持。
本站涵盖的内容、图片、视频等数据系网络收集,部分未能与原作者取得联系。若涉及版权问题,请联系我们进行删除!谢谢大家!
随着科技的飞速发展,算法在各个领域的应用日益广泛。从搜索引擎到自动驾驶,从金融风控到医疗诊断,算法已经成为了现代科技的核心驱动力。算法的运行离不开强大的算力支持。本文将深入探讨算法运行的算力,分析其重要性以及提升策略。
一、算法运行的算力的重要性
1. 影响算法性能:算力是算法运行的基础,它决定了算法的执行速度和效果。强大的算力可以使算法更快地处理海量数据,提高算法的准确性和效率。
2. 适应复杂场景:在复杂的应用场景中,算法需要处理的数据量和计算量巨大。强大的算力可以帮助算法在短时间内完成复杂的计算任务,适应各种复杂场景。
3. 促进技术创新:随着算力的不断提升,算法的边界也在不断拓展。强大的算力为技术创新提供了有力支持,推动了人工智能、大数据等领域的快速发展。
二、提升算法运行的算力策略
1. 优化算法设计:在算法设计阶段,充分考虑算法的复杂度和计算量,采用高效的算法模型和算法优化技术,降低算法对算力的需求。
2. 采用并行计算:将算法分解成多个子任务,通过并行计算的方式提高算法的执行效率。现代计算机体系结构,如GPU、FPGA等,为并行计算提供了良好的硬件支持。
3. 利用云计算资源:借助云计算平台,将算法运行在分布式计算环境中,充分利用云计算资源,提高算法运行的算力。
4. 开发专用硬件:针对特定算法,开发专用硬件加速器,如神经网络处理器、图像处理芯片等,以降低算法对算力的需求。
5. 优化数据存储和传输:在算法运行过程中,合理优化数据存储和传输方式,减少数据访问延迟,提高算法的执行效率。
6. 节能降耗:在提升算力的注重节能降耗,降低算法运行过程中的能耗,实现可持续发展。
算法运行的算力是影响算法性能和推广应用的关键因素。在人工智能、大数据等领域的快速发展中,提升算法运行的算力具有重要意义。通过优化算法设计、采用并行计算、利用云计算资源、开发专用硬件、优化数据存储和传输以及节能降耗等策略,可以有效提升算法运行的算力,为我国科技创新和产业升级提供有力支持。
本站涵盖的内容、图片、视频等数据系网络收集,部分未能与原作者取得联系。若涉及版权问题,请联系我们进行删除!谢谢大家!
